Bercow looks above the parapet

Bercow, the new speaker of the House of Commons, has noticed that people are pretty fed up with the £25 a day unreceipted subsistance allowance that went through on a nod and has decided to call for a meeting of the members estimate committee next week.

Already Nick Harvey is claiming the story of the allowance has been blown out of proportion and all this was agreed way back in March.

Strange how MPs have been managing to claim on this allowance, but none of them actually bothered to pipe up and mention that the subsistance allowance didn't require any receipts. Even stranger it wasn't until the story gathered pace today that Bercow noticed the problem.
